The house was built around 1890 by William F. Meyer, Sr. and his wife Mary (nee Sievert). They were (born about 1859 and 1863 respectively. The cost to build the house was $5,000 and at that time the house had gas lights, kerosene lamps, wood burning stoves and outdoor plumbing.
